Women in brewing focus for latest CAMRA podcast

The popular CAMRA podcast Pubs. Pints. People. continues its sixth season with Women in the brewhouse, an episode that shines a light on the key roles they play in brewing and in the beer and cider communities.   Listeners can hear from Tara Nurin, author of A Women’s Place is in the Brewhouse: A Forgotten History of Alewives, Brewsters, Witches and CEOs. The hosts also explore the topic of women in beer and cider today and in the future plus highlight Jules Gray from Sheffield’s Hop Hideout, Jaega Wise of Wild Card brewery and the upcoming Women on Tap Festival at the end of May.
